Output c2db8c24c4e955cf1e3085a22a5cdb6a305d5cc05e1ae86cf4b782d68f2bf973:0

value
23847240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d57f6ecec0d153e00cdffd837d04d6e5d56116 OP_EQUAL
address
31riMpcVjvia6y9HGZApuksbwjoN6Qnsqo
transaction
c2db8c24c4e955cf1e3085a22a5cdb6a305d5cc05e1ae86cf4b782d68f2bf973
confirmations
329903
spent
true